Description

Forest correcting device
Technical Field
The utility model belongs to the technical field of garden equipment, specifically be a forest orthotic devices.
Background
Forestry refers to the process of utilizing the natural characteristics of forest trees to protect the ecological environment and maintain ecological balance, and cultivating and protecting forests to obtain woods and other forest products. In the forestry planting process, the bent trees need to be corrected so that the saplings can grow normally and grow stronger. In the process of straightening a curved tree, a straightening device is needed.
At present, the support frame is very simple, and the majority is that the stick is directly inserted and is used for supporting or correcting the skew of trees in earth, and this kind of support is easy to be disconnected, can't keep the stable condition under the circumstances of supporting for a long time simultaneously to current correction device all lets trees both sides produce corresponding holding power in growing, makes the woods slowly become straight from the bending state when growing, and present support frame can't produce the holding power to trees according to actual conditions and adjusts.
Therefore, how to design a forest straightening device becomes a problem to be solved at present.

The working principle is as follows:
firstly, when a user clamps a trunk between a first fixed hoop 2 and a second fixed hoop 5, and then screws in the big bolt 11 through a nut 12, so that the first fixed hoop 2 and the second fixed hoop 5 on both sides are better attached to the trunk, and when the top fixed hoop and the bottom fixed hoop are attached to the bottom of the trunk, the top fixed hoop and the bottom fixed hoop are connected with each other because the front end and the rear end of the trunk are provided with a lifting cylinder 9, because the user can fix the adjusting connecting column 8 at both ends through the lifting cylinder 9, the connecting column 8 can drive the big bolt 11 to be fixed through a sleeve 10, the big bolt 11 can drive the first fixed hoop 2 and the second fixed hoop 5 on both sides to be fixed, thereby preventing one of the fixed hoops from generating displacement, meanwhile, the two sides of the fixed hoop can be supported through a telescopic column 3, the telescopic column 3 can be placed on a base 6 and fixed through the big bolt 11 and the nut 12, then the supporting cone 7 is inserted into the ground to be kept stable by using the base 6, the base 6 is stable and can be stabilized by the telescopic column 3 through the two fixing hoops, the correcting device main body 1 is provided with a stabilizing mechanism, the supporting cone 7 in the stabilizing mechanism can prevent the fixing hoops from moving up and down through the ground, and meanwhile, the lifting cylinder 9 in the stabilizing mechanism can prevent the two fixing hoops from moving up and down, so that the stability of the correcting device main body 1 in long-term use is greatly improved;
then, a fixing plate 604 is arranged at the connection position between the base 6 and the supporting cone 7, and the fixing plate 604 is made of a thicker steel plate, so that when a user knocks the supporting cone 7 into the ground through a tool, the fixing plate 604 can help the supporting cone 7 to support and bear the weight, thereby preventing the base 6 from being damaged due to overweight when the user knocks the supporting cone;
then, when the user passes through the corresponding holes at the bottom of the track 601 and the telescopic column 3 of the placing seat 603 through the large bolt 11, the telescopic column 3 is fixed in the middle of the placing seat 603, and then the large bolt 11 is clamped on the track 601 of the placing seat 603 by holding the nut 12, so as to prevent the large bolt 11 from being separated from the track 601, after the user fixes the telescopic column 3 at one side inside the placing seat 603, the user inserts the gravity columns with different weights into the inserting columns 602 in front of and behind the telescopic column 3, so that the gravity columns can generate corresponding supporting resistance when the telescopic column 3 moves, so that the telescopic column 3 cannot generate displacement when in use, and the supporting resistance generated by all the required gravity columns is different due to the different curved radian of the trunk, and thus the gravity columns are divided into a small gravity column 605 and a large gravity column 606, the volume of the large gravity column 606 is larger than that of the small gravity column 605, and therefore the supporting resistance generated by the large gravity column 606 is also larger than that generated by the small gravity column 605 In the same way, users can make different volume gravity columns, so that the users can conveniently adjust the volume of the inserted gravity column according to actual conditions, and the adjustability of the utility model is greatly improved;
next, when a user wants to adjust the supporting angle between the top fixing hoop (composed of the first fixing hoop 2, the second fixing hoop 5, the large bolt 11 and the nut 12) and the bottom fixing hoop, the user can unscrew the nuts 12 at the small bolts 13 at the two sides of the bottom fixing hoop, and after the nuts 12 at the small bolts 13 are unscrewed, the user drives the bottom fixing hoop to move upwards, and when the bottom fixing hoop moves, the adjusting column 4 rotates and drives the bottom of the telescopic column 3 to move, so that the user can conveniently adjust the height of the bottom fixing hoop according to the situation;
